This project aims to advance the design of lightweight, strong materials for various applications, including automotive and aerospace. By developing new computational tools for analyzing nonlinear dynamic performance, it seeks to optimize material structures for improved safety and efficiency.
Imagine lighter and more fuel economic cars with improved crashworthiness that help save lives, aircrafts and wind-turbine blades with significant weight reductions that lead to large savings in material costs and environmental impact, and light but efficient armour that helps to protect against potentially deadly blasts.
